A Grid Troubleshooting Method Based on Fuzzy Event
Abstract
Formalized analyzing the situation of grid and the target of fault diagnosis, a new method--FTFD for grid troubleshooting based on fuzzy event is proposed. By introducing situation-detection function, FTFD can characterize complicated fuzzy fault with accurate mathematics conversion, and "abnormal degree" can be defined by the vector of probability with belief functions. The method can effectively reduce false positives and negative positives. It aims to be applied to real-time fault diagnosis. The operational prototypical system demonstrates its feasibility and gets the effectiveness of real-time fault diagnosis.
